Abstract

PURPOSE:To obtain effective pressure for sure simply in a device to convey solid materials and the like by running fluid in pipes by blowing pressurized fluid into pipes in the direction of conveyance for reducing the area of the running section of the fluid in pipes. CONSTITUTION:Annular chests 2-2b are fitted round the outer wall of a main pipe 1 to convey solid materials by fluid pressure, covering annular slits 5 provided to face top parts of taper pipes 3-3b connected with the main pipe 1 to the expanded part 4 at the end of the main pipe 1. The top parts of the taper pipes 3-3b are contracted inside to form narrow parts 6. In this construction, when pressurized air is sent into the annular chests 2 and 2a from a compressor 10 via airpipes 7 and 7a, the pressurized air is blown into the main pipe 1 through annular slits 5. Thereby, the fluid in the main pipe 1 is contracted as arrows 8 show, and reduced in its sectional area. A high speed thus given causes a sucking force, and solid materials are drawn as an arrow 9 shows.
